Pneumatic systems play a crucial role in various industries, including manufacturing, automotive, and aerospace. These systems utilize compressed air to power different mechanisms and perform a wide range of tasks. From controlling robotic arms to operating automated machinery, pneumatic systems offer efficiency, reliability, and precision.
